Wire Mesh: A Durable and Versatile Material

Wire mesh is a ubiquitous material utilized in various applications across industries. Constructed from interwoven wires, it provides exceptional toughness. The open configuration of wire mesh allows for efficient airflow and permeability, making it suitable for applications such as filtration. Its adaptability stems from the ability to customize its size, material, and weave pattern to meet specific demands.

Wire mesh is widely used in construction for tasks such as reinforcing concrete, creating protective barriers, and facilitating ventilation. It's also essential in industries like aerospace, automotive, and food processing for applications ranging from filtration to structural support.

Setting Up Wire Mesh: Tips and Techniques

Getting your wire mesh fitted correctly is essential for its function. First, you'll need to measure the area you need to protect. Once you have that figured out, select a wire mesh material ideal for your needs. Consider factors like durability, strength, and mesh size.

Next, ready the surface where you'll be installing the wire mesh. Ensure it's clean, level, and free of any debris or obstructions.

Leverage the appropriate fasteners to hold your wire mesh to the surface. This could involve things like staples, nails, zip ties, or even adhesive. Make sure to arrange the fasteners evenly for maximum stability.

For angled surfaces, you may need to cut the wire mesh to fit the contours. This can be done with tin snips or other appropriate cutting tools. Remember to always wear safety glasses when working with sharp tools.

Finally, inspect your work to ensure that the wire mesh is tightly attached and free of any gaps or loose areas. A well-installed wire mesh will deliver long-lasting protection and enhance the functionality of your installation.
